Appeal No. 94-0166 Application No. 07/815,316 The appealed claims stand rejected as follows: (1) Claims 1 through 5 under 35 U.S.C. § 103 as unpatentable in view of the combined disclosures of Fazan and Liu; and (2) Claims 1 through 5 under 35 U.S.C. § 112, first paragraph, as lacking adequate written description for the limitation “depositing a layer of conformal dielectric, said layer contacting at least a portion of said gate electrodes” in the disclosure as originally filed. We reverse each of the above rejections. OBVIOUSNESS Appellants dispute the examiner’s findings that Fazan’s “polysilicon layer 61 matches the landing pad’s conditions” (Answer, page 4) defined in the specification (Specification page 2, lines 10-11) and forms “a landing pad contacting said substrate” in accordance with the method of claim 1. The dispositive question is, therefore, whether the prior art relied upon by the examiner describes or would have suggested “forming a landing pad contacting said substrate” in accordance with claim 1. We answer this question in the negative. 3Page: Previous 1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 10 NextLast modified: November 3, 2007
